Legalized mobile home on urban plot
41 m² legalized mobile home with three bedrooms on a 2,800 m² urban plot in Hontoba, plus a 16 m² independent storage building, utilities and a first-occupancy licence.

This is a shortlisting pass over the advert's data, not a due diligence report. Before deciding, check the points we cannot verify from here:
- The real service charge and, above all, whether any special levies are approved or pending: they appear in the minutes of the last owners' meetings.
- The property's actual IBI: our figure is an estimate from the municipality's cadastral values, not the specific bill.
- Charges, mortgages, seizures or easements in the Land Registry extract.
